Future Watch: Nolan Patrick Hockey Rookie Cards – Nolan Patrick has a chance to be the 1st overall pick in the 2017 NHL Entry Draft. Knowing how fluid a ranking like that can be, anything is possible so this isn’t a lock by any stretch of the imagination.

His father, Steve, played for the Buffalo Sabres and the New York Rangers. His uncle, James also played for those two clubs among others. Both were first round picks and now another Patrick is a guaranteed first round pick. That’s a stone cold lock.

Last year, the Winnipeg-born center had 56 points in 55 games. He also netted 15 in the playoffs helping to make the Brandon Wheat Kings, of the WHL an even stronger team. This year he topped that with 102 points in 71 games including  41 regular season goals. His 30 points in 21 playoff games helped propel his team to a nice Memorial Cup run.

Besides being a WHL champion he was the playoff MVP at the tender age of 17. He’s currently 6′-3″, 195 pounds and probably still growing. When his man strength eventually kicks in he’ll be a nightmare for opposing defenseman.

Leaf Trading Cards is the only company currently able to include the young phenom in their products. Collectors can find his autographed cards in 2014-15 Leaf Signature Series Hockey 2015-16 Leaf Metal Hockey and 2015-16 Leaf ITG Heroes & Prospects Hockey.

He’s a smooth skater, with a great worth ethic, solid two-way game and he wins a fair amount of face-offs. By next year he’s expected to be one of the best players in junior hockey and then after he’s drafted, the sky’s the limit.
